Analysis

Togo recorded 5,494 deaths for hiv/aids deaths averted by antiretroviral therapy in 2024.

That represents a change of down 2.0% on the previous year and up 32.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, hiv/aids deaths averted by antiretroviral therapy in Togo peaked at 5,736 deaths in 2022 and was at its lowest, 0 deaths, in 1990.

Togo ranks 35th of 157 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

HIV/AIDS deaths averted by antiretroviral therapy in Togo, year by year

Annual values for HIV/AIDS deaths averted by antiretroviral therapy in Togo, 1990 to 2024.
Year deaths Change
1990 0 deaths
1991 0 deaths
1992 0 deaths
1993 0 deaths
1994 0 deaths
1995 0 deaths
1996 0 deaths
1997 0 deaths
1998 0 deaths
1999 0 deaths
2000 0 deaths
2001 0 deaths
2002 25.02 deaths
2003 197.85 deaths +690.8%
2004 480.13 deaths +142.7%
2005 1,069 deaths +122.6%
2006 1,600 deaths +49.7%
2007 1,632 deaths +2.0%
2008 1,876 deaths +14.9%
2009 2,528 deaths +34.8%
2010 3,401 deaths +34.5%
2011 4,085 deaths +20.1%
2012 4,200 deaths +2.8%
2013 4,159 deaths -1.0%
2014 4,144 deaths -0.3%
2015 4,345 deaths +4.8%
2016 4,673 deaths +7.6%
2017 4,780 deaths +2.3%
2018 5,037 deaths +5.4%
2019 5,334 deaths +5.9%
2020 5,517 deaths +3.4%
2021 5,666 deaths +2.7%
2022 5,736 deaths +1.2%
2023 5,604 deaths -2.3%
2024 5,494 deaths -2.0%

Number of deaths prevented as a direct result of Antiretroviral Therapy (ART) among people living with HIV. It is calculated by comparing the observed mortality rates in individuals receiving ART to the estimated mortality rates in the absence of such treatment. This is the central estimate.
